A Pop Culture Icon: The Enduring Appeal of Hilary Duff
Hilary Duff isn't just a musician; she's a bona fide pop culture phenomenon whose career has spanned decades, evolving with her and captivating multiple generations. Her journey from child star to accomplished actress, singer, and entrepreneur is a testament to her talent, resilience, and undeniable charm.
Born in Houston, Texas, in 1987, Duff's early career was defined by her breakout role as the titular character in the Disney Channel series Lizzie McGuire (2001-2004). The show, which resonated with pre-teens and teens worldwide, catapulted her to international fame. However, it was her parallel music career that truly cemented her status as a teen idol.
Her debut album, “Metamorphosis” (2003), was a critical and commercial success, spawning chart-topping singles like "So Yesterday" and the infectious "Come Clean." This album showcased a more mature pop sound, moving beyond the Disney saccharine and demonstrating her vocal prowess. Subsequent albums, including “Hilary Duff” (2004) and “Most Wanted” (2005), continued her dominance on the charts, featuring hits such as "Wake Up" and "Fuller." She achieved significant global sales, with over 15 million records sold worldwide by the mid-2000s.
While her music career took a backseat for a period as she focused on her acting ventures – with roles in films like A Cinderella Story (2004) and The Perfect Man (2005), and later, the critically acclaimed TV series Younger (2015-2021) – the desire to return to her musical roots burned brightly.

Canadian Tire Centre: A Premier Entertainment Hub in Kanata
The Canadian Tire Centre, located in Kanata, a suburb of Ottawa, is the premier entertainment and sports venue in the National Capital Region. Opened in 1996 as the Palladium, and later known as the Corel Centre and Scotiabank Place, it has been home to the Ottawa Senators of the National Hockey League and has hosted a dazzling array of world-class concerts, sporting events, and family shows.
Venue Specifics:
- Capacity: The Canadian Tire Centre boasts a substantial capacity, typically seating around 17,000 for hockey and slightly more for concerts, depending on stage setup. This ensures a buzzing atmosphere without feeling overwhelmingly vast.
- Seating: The arena offers a variety of seating options, from floor seating offering an up-close and personal experience, to tiered seating in the lower and upper bowls, providing excellent sightlines of the stage. Premium suites and club seats are also available for those seeking an elevated experience.
- Acoustics: The venue is designed with modern acoustic principles in mind, aiming to provide clear and immersive sound for musical performances. While opinions on venue acoustics can be subjective, the Canadian Tire Centre generally receives positive feedback for its sound quality for large-scale concerts.
- Accessibility: The Canadian Tire Centre is committed to providing an accessible experience for all patrons. Accessible seating is available, and the venue is equipped with elevators, accessible restrooms, and other amenities. It's always advisable to book accessible tickets in advance through the official ticketing partner to ensure your needs are met.

Navigating Your Way to the Canadian Tire Centre
Kanata is situated to the west of Ottawa’s downtown core, and the Canadian Tire Centre is easily accessible by car and public transport.
By Car:
The Canadian Tire Centre is conveniently located just off Highway 417 (the Queensway).
- From Downtown Ottawa: Take Highway 417 West. Take Exit 128 for Palladium Drive/Kanata Avenue. Follow signs for the Canadian Tire Centre.
- From the East: Take Highway 417 West. Follow the same directions as from Downtown Ottawa.
- From the West: Take Highway 417 East. Take Exit 128 for Palladium Drive/Kanata Avenue. Follow signs for the Canadian Tire Centre.
Parking:
The Canadian Tire Centre offers extensive on-site parking, with designated areas for general admission and preferred parking.
- General Parking: Available in various lots surrounding the arena. Fees typically apply and can vary per event. It’s wise to check the Canadian Tire Centre website for the most up-to-date parking rates for the Hilary Duff concert.
- Preferred Parking: Offers closer proximity to the arena entrances for an additional fee. This can be pre-purchased or purchased on-site, subject to availability.
- Ride-Sharing and Taxis: Designated drop-off and pick-up zones are available for ride-sharing services (Uber, Lyft) and taxis. These are usually clearly marked and located within a short walking distance of the arena entrances. This is an excellent option to consider to avoid parking hassles.
By Public Transit (OC Transpo):
OC Transpo operates dedicated bus routes to and from the Canadian Tire Centre, particularly for major events.
- Route Information: It is crucial to check the OC Transpo website (www.octranspo.com) closer to the event date for any special event service information. They often schedule additional buses and adjust routes to accommodate concertgoers.
- Fares: Standard OC Transpo fares apply. Consider purchasing a day pass or using your Presto card for convenience.
- Travel Time: Allow ample travel time, especially if coming from downtown or other parts of the city, as bus routes can involve multiple stops.

Fan Tips for a Flawless Hilary Duff Experience
To make sure your night with Hilary Duff at the Canadian Tire Centre is as smooth and enjoyable as possible, here are some insider tips:
- Arrival Time: Aim to arrive at least 1.5 to 2 hours before the scheduled start time. This gives you ample time for parking, security checks, finding your seats, grabbing a drink or merchandise, and soaking in the pre-show atmosphere.
- Bag Policy: Familiarise yourself with the Canadian Tire Centre's bag policy before you leave home. Many venues have restrictions on bag size and type to expedite security screening. Typically, clear bags or small clutch purses are permitted. Check their official website for the most current guidelines.
- Merchandise Strategy: Artist merchandise is always a hot commodity. If you have your heart set on a specific t-shirt or souvenir, consider purchasing it early in the evening or during the opening act to avoid long queues during Hilary's set. Alternatively, some venues offer online merchandise ordering for pickup.
- Phone Etiquette: While we all love to capture memories, be mindful of others' viewing experience. Keep your phone screen brightness low and avoid prolonged recording that obstructs the view of those behind you. Many artists now have official event hashtags – use those to share your experience!
- Comfortable Footwear: You'll likely be doing a lot of standing, dancing, and navigating concourses. Comfortable shoes are an absolute must.
- Ear Protection: For some, especially those with sensitive hearing or who plan to be near the front, earplugs designed for concerts can significantly enhance enjoyment by reducing ear fatigue while still allowing you to appreciate the music.
- Stay Hydrated: As mentioned, drinking water is crucial. There are water fountains available throughout the venue, and you can often bring in an empty, reusable water bottle (check the venue policy!) to refill.
